Ackworth School, located at the heart of Pontefract, is a distinguished independent co-educational institution that has been providing quality education since its founding in 1779. With a strong Quaker ethos, the school emphasises values such as acceptance, respect, and ethical decision-making. This ethos permeates all aspects of school life, fostering an environment where students from diverse backgrounds can thrive both academically and personally.
The school offers a comprehensive educational journey for boys and girls aged two to 18, with options for day, weekly/flexible boarding, and full boarding. Coram House, the nursery and junior school division, provides a nurturing environment where learning extends beyond traditional classroom settings. The forest school sessions are particularly noteworthy, immersing young learners in nature through hands-on activities that develop practical skills and a love for the natural world. Weekly swimming lessons further promote physical fitness and water safety from an early age. The emphasis on sustainability is evident in the school’s commitment to environmental stewardship, encouraging students to care for their surroundings.
In the senior school, personalised education is prioritised through small class sizes that allow teachers to focus on each student’s unique strengths. The facilities are impressive, featuring spacious science laboratories, exceptional art and drama spaces, and a renowned music centre equipped with eight Steinway pianos. Sports play a vital role in student life, with facilities including a professional-level fitness suite, indoor swimming pool, tennis and squash courts. The table tennis and football academies offer elite training opportunities for aspiring athletes.

The school’s approach to boarding is dynamic and accommodating, recognising that every family’s situation is unique. Flexi-boarding options offer senior students the convenience of overnight stays when needed, providing a conducive environment for study and social interaction. This experience helps cultivate independence and prepares students for university life and beyond.
The Duke of Edinburgh’s Award programme is another highlight of the school’s offering. Through this initiative, students embark on journeys of self-discovery and outdoor exploration while developing essential life skills. From bronze and silver awards in Years 10 and 11 to the prestigious gold award in the sixth form, participants make positive contributions to their communities.
